Prioritizing Self-Care and Resources

Caring for a loved one with a chronic illness is demanding, making self-care essential. Caregivers must prioritize their own well-being to maintain their physical and emotional health. ANI offers resources such as support groups, counseling services, and respite care to help caregivers find balance, manage stress, and recharge.

Effective Communication and Active Listening

Open and effective communication is crucial in the caregiver-patient relationship. Caregivers must actively listen, validate feelings, and provide emotional support to their loved ones. ANI provides guidance on effective communication techniques, facilitating shared decision-making, and engaging in honest conversations with healthcare professionals.

Community and Peer Support

Connecting with others who share similar experiences can provide invaluable support. ANI encourages caregivers to seek community and peer support networks, both online and in person. These networks offer understanding, empathy, and practical advice, helping caregivers feel less isolated and more empowered.
